乐高编程有点难学吗为什么
-
乐高编程在初学者来说可能会感觉有点难学,主要有以下几个原因:
-
抽象思维:乐高编程需要学习编程语言,掌握编程的基本概念和逻辑思维。对于初学者来说,这种抽象思维可能会有一定的难度。
-
多任务处理:乐高编程通常需要处理多个任务或多个传感器的输入。初学者可能会感到困惑,如何同时处理多个任务并使它们协同工作。
-
错误排查:在编程过程中,错误是常见的。初学者可能会遇到一些错误,如语法错误、逻辑错误等。找出并修复错误可能需要一些时间和经验。
-
编程环境:乐高编程通常使用专门的编程软件,如乐高Mindstorms软件。初学者可能需要一些时间来熟悉和掌握这个软件的使用。
然而,尽管乐高编程可能有一些挑战,但它也有许多优点:
-
创造性:乐高编程可以激发孩子们的创造力和想象力。他们可以设计和构建自己的机器人,并编写程序使其执行各种任务。
-
实践应用:乐高编程可以将理论知识应用于实际情境中。学生们可以通过编程来解决问题,提高解决问题的能力。
-
团队合作:乐高编程通常需要团队合作,学生们可以一起设计和构建机器人,并共同编写程序。这有助于培养他们的团队合作和沟通能力。
-
跨学科学习:乐高编程结合了科学、技术、工程和数学等学科,学生们可以在实践中综合运用这些知识。
总之,尽管乐高编程可能有一些挑战,但通过克服困难和不断实践,学生们可以逐渐掌握乐高编程,并享受到它带来的乐趣和好处。
1年前 -
-
乐高编程对于初学者来说可能有一些难度,这是由于以下几个原因:
-
抽象思维:乐高编程要求学习者具备一定的抽象思维能力。编程涉及到将现实世界的问题转化为计算机可理解的指令,需要学习者能够理解和应用抽象概念,如变量、循环、条件语句等。
-
逻辑思维:编程需要学习者具备良好的逻辑思维能力。编写程序需要按照一定的逻辑顺序组织代码,学习者需要能够理解和应用条件语句、循环语句、函数等概念,以正确地实现预期的功能。
-
学习曲线:乐高编程作为一门技术,需要学习者从零开始学习,逐渐掌握基本的编程概念和技巧。学习者需要通过不断的实践和练习,逐步提高自己的编程能力。这个过程可能需要一定的时间和耐心。
-
复杂性:乐高编程涉及到许多不同的概念和技术,如传感器、控制流、数据结构等。学习者需要掌握这些概念,并能够将它们应用到实际的问题中。这需要一定的学习和实践。
-
编程语言:乐高编程使用的是图形化编程语言,对于初学者来说可能需要一定的时间来适应这种编程方式。学习者需要理解图形化编程语言的语法和逻辑,以及如何使用它们来控制乐高积木。
总结起来,乐高编程可能对初学者来说有一定的难度,需要学习者具备抽象思维、逻辑思维和耐心。然而,通过不断的学习和实践,学习者可以逐渐提高自己的编程能力,并且享受到乐高编程带来的乐趣和成就感。
1年前 -
-
乐高编程对于初学者来说可能会有一些难度,但并不是特别困难。以下是一些可能使乐高编程有点难学的原因:
-
概念理解:乐高编程需要理解一些基本的编程概念,比如循环、条件、变量等。对于没有编程经验的初学者来说,这些概念可能会有一定的难度。
-
语言学习:乐高编程使用一种叫做乐高编程语言(LEGO Programming Language)的语言。对于初学者来说,学习一种新的编程语言可能会有一定的困难。
-
抽象思维:乐高编程需要学习如何将问题抽象化,并将其转化为计算机可以理解的指令。这种抽象思维对于一些人来说可能不是很容易掌握。
-
逻辑思维:编程需要一定的逻辑思维能力,包括理解问题的逻辑关系、解决问题的步骤等。对于一些人来说,逻辑思维可能需要一定的训练和练习。
-
实践经验:乐高编程需要通过实践来学习和掌握。对于初学者来说,可能需要一定的时间来积累实践经验,才能更好地理解和应用乐高编程。
为了克服这些困难,可以采取以下方法:
-
学习资料:寻找适合初学者的乐高编程学习资料,如教程、视频等,以帮助理解乐高编程的基本概念和操作流程。
-
实践项目:通过完成一些简单的乐高编程项目来提高实践能力。可以从简单的项目开始,逐渐增加难度,以巩固所学知识。
-
参与社区:加入乐高编程的社区,与其他乐高编程爱好者交流经验和学习心得。在社区中可以获得帮助和支持,提高学习效果。
-
坚持练习:乐高编程需要持续的练习和实践。通过不断地练习,可以提高编程能力和解决问题的能力。
总的来说,乐高编程可能对初学者来说有一定的难度,但通过合适的学习方法和坚持不懈的练习,是可以很好地掌握乐高编程的。
1年前 -